摘要:To investigate the effects of intercropping and applying Pterocypsela laciniata straws on potassium uptake of grape seedlings, this pot experiment was conducted to set up five treatments under selenium stress. From the results, the content of total K in parts of plants was different. In plants, the content in leaf was higher than that in root or stem. Among five treatments, applying P. laciniata straws always decreased the total K content in plants. Furthermore, intercropping with P. laciniata seedlings could increase the content in stem, leaf and shoot of grape seedlings. So the results showed that applying root, stem and leaf straws of P. laciniata could not improve nutrient accumulation or the growth of grape seedlings. But for the available K content, it was on the increase by intercropping and applying straws. Among them, applying stem straw of P. laciniata made the content higher. Although there was higher available K content in soil by applying straws, the total K content in plants was lower. Thus, applying P. laciniata straws was not effective on the growth of grape plant.
